Artist Biography

Karinda Ristic is an emerging abstract artist originally from Cape Town, South Africa and is now living in Ontario, Canada. She creates ethereal abstract landscapes with mixed media, exploring the inner journey of one’s authentic self and being a part of this beautiful planet we live on. She is mostly self-taught, although she enjoys learning new skills through participating in many different art courses over the years. Initially she worked with acrylic paints, but her artwork has organically shifted over the last 8 years, since during this time she has moved around the world with her partner and two children. This has given her a unique perspective of the world and now she mostly works with fluid ink mediums and sews into the canvas with embroidery thread. Karinda has participated in a variety of group exhibitions in Canada. One of her highlights was when she was invited to do a talk at the opening event of the Unity Art group exhibition in British Columbia. Her work has also been published in a variety of international art magazines.

Artist Statement

Karinda Ristic is a creator of personal journeys through ethereal contemporary landscape paintings. This creative process is a combination of what she sees and what she feels. An instinctive process, each painting is a planted seed that connects her a little deeper to her authentic self, mapping the journey and bringing her closer to the land and her personal healing. With each brush stroke, the medium flows freely onto the canvas. The process is a powerful guide and she surrenders to the canvas, lets go and trusts in the journey. The very nature of this medium transports her into an existential state of mind allowing her to interact with the painting in the moment, otherwise the fusing of herself and the canvas becomes blurred. Each landscape is an organic experience that allows her to express her journey in layers of colour, space and luminosity. These diverse somewhat cryptic characteristics expose a deep connection between the viewer, the artist and the artwork. As a final touch, Karinda sews embroidery thread into the canvas. This not only acts as her personal signature, but it also amplifies the organic nature of the work and creates interesting lines and textures.  The thread can be seen as a form of surgery, bonding and strengthening the layers of colour, space and luminescence.
